Job Description:

STR is seeking a Chief Scientist to develop cutting-edge AI technologies with significant and immediate impact on our national security. This individual will lead a diverse team to create innovative solutions that leverage emerging technology in generative AI, reinforcement learning and other AI disciplines. They will also be responsible for technical marketing and proposal writing; building world-class teams and cultivating strategic customer relationships.

Job Responsibility:

  • Technical marketing to existing and potential customers
  • Technical proposal development (idea generation, writing, reviewing, editing)
  • Creating innovative solutions to challenging AI problems
  • Leading teams to design, develop, implement, test and analyze solutions to national security problems
  • Serving as primary technical point of contact to customers, co-contractors, and subcontractors

Requirements:

  • Active Top Secret (TS) Security Clearance, for which U.S citizenship is needed by the U.S government
  • Entrepreneurial spirit eager to engage in technical marketing and business development
  • Proven track record in writing and winning technical proposals
  • Substantial experience leading technical teams on advanced R&D programs (e.g., DARPA, AFRL, ONR, ARL research projects)
  • Experience developing mathematical and physics-based algorithms for constraint-based search and optimization, autonomy and planning, machine learning, networking, or agent-based software design
  • Motivated collaborator and effective communicator to both technical and non-technical audiences
  • Experience working with the Department of Defense (or Intelligence Community) on cyber related technology
  • PhD or MS in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Mathematics, or related field with 10-13+ years of relevant experience
